Verdict

SEARCHINGTHEBLUES ran well when third behind a couple of improvers at Kempton last time and she could be ready to take advantage of her reduced mark. Moostar has often been in the mix for her current yard and is feared most in a change of headgear, ahead of Pickersgill.
